Output 28068c5f14fdb03daa78159bae4132aea547e57718478c8197abee9032f9e958:0

value
416038
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 124a1d0e8ef0ca3088b060222c0a299a8f42afe9 OP_EQUALVERIFY OP_CHECKSIG
address
12fhwx4v9MbutETs6gi7Z6sKonhwf68qBr
transaction
28068c5f14fdb03daa78159bae4132aea547e57718478c8197abee9032f9e958
confirmations
248442
spent
true